    British Airways Flight Lands Safely in Newark after Security Alert

    British airwaysA British Airways flight made an emergency landing at Newark Liberty International Airport in Newark, on June 1st.

    Authorities said a security alert was issued about the British Airways plane that was flying from London, United Kingdom.

    An airline spokesperson said, “The aircraft has landed normally. Security checks will carried out as a precaution…We do not discuss details of operational security. The safety and security of our customers and crew is our number one priority.”

    The plane was carrying 206 passengers and 13 crew members at the time.

    Budapest Air Service Plane Returns to Savonlinna, Finland, due to Landing Gear Issue

    FlexFlight flight W2-5650, operated by Budapest Air Service, returned to Savonlinna, Finland, on November 21st.

    The plane took off for Helsinki, Finland, but had to turn back after the crew failed to retract the landing gear.

    The plane landed back uneventfully. All thirteen passengers aboard remained safe.

    Swiss Global Air Lines Flight Makes Emergency Landing due to Brakes Problem

    Swiss Global Air Lines flight LX-1248 made an emergency landing in Stockholm, Sweden, on April 7th.

    The plane flying from Zurich, Switzerland, was on final approach to Stockholm when the crew reported an issue with the brakes and went around.

    The plane subsequently landed safely. All passengers and crew members remained unharmed.

    Swiss International Air Lines Flight Makes Emergency Landing in Johannesburg

    Swiss International Air Lines flight LX-289 made an emergency landing in Johannesburg, South Africa, on January 1st.

    The Airbus A340-300 plane took off for Zurich, Switzerland, but had to turn back due to issues with the weather radar.

    The plane landed safely. There were two hundred and nineteen passengers aboard at the time; all of them remained safe.

    Delta Airlines Plane Returns to Narita International Airport

    250px-Delta_logo.svgA Delta airlines flight had to make an emergency landing at Narita International Airport, Japan, on January 23.

    The Boeing 757-200 was en-route to Saipan when the crew decided to return due to smoke in the cabin.

    The plane landed uneventfully. All 97 passengers and crew members remained unharmed.

    United Airlines Flight Returns to San Francisco due to Fuel System Problem

    United Airlines flight UA-58 had to return and make an emergency landing in San Francisco, California, on September 21st.

    The Boeing 777-300 plane took off for Frankfurt, Germany, but had to turn back due to an issue with the fuel system.

    The plane landed back safely. All passengers and crew members remained unharmed.
